Understanding Iron & Hardness Challenges in Well Water

Well water's unique composition presents significant challenges for rural homeowners across America. The double threat of hardness and iron contamination can wreak havoc on household plumbing systems, appliances, and water quality.

High concentrations of calcium and magnesium create hard water that leaves scale deposits, while iron exists in two problematic forms: soluble ferrous iron and insoluble ferric iron.

Iron levels can range from moderate (0.3 ppm) to extreme (exceeding 25 ppm), causing everything from rust stains to clogged pipes.

Hard water leaves damaging scale while iron contaminants stain fixtures and clog systems at concentrations from barely visible to extreme.

What makes treatment complex is that conventional water softeners often fall short when iron concentrations exceed 1 ppm.

That's why specialized systems combining ion exchange technology with oxidation processes are typically needed to effectively address both problems simultaneously in well water systems.

Comparing Technologies: Air Injection vs. Chemical Oxidation Systems

While battling iron and hardness in your well water, the technology behind your water softener can make all the difference in effectiveness and maintenance requirements.

Air injection systems like the SpringWell WS and SoftPro IronMaster leverage oxidation to transform dissolved iron and manganese into filterable particles, requiring minimal maintenance.

With flow rates of 6-20 GPM, they're adaptable to various household sizes and offer a chemical-free solution.

Air injection technology creates a maintenance-friendly solution that naturally converts iron into easily filtered particles without chemicals.

In contrast, chemical oxidation systems such as the US Water Systems Matrixx Infusion use hydrogen peroxide to tackle higher levels of hydrogen sulfide and intense sulfur odors.

Though they provide comparable flow rates, these systems typically demand media replacement every 3-5 years.

We've found that air injection systems work best for standard iron removal, while chemical oxidation excels when dealing with severe sulfur odors and concentrated iron issues.

Will a Water Softener Remove Iron From Well Water?

We'll need more than a standard softener for high iron levels. While they'll remove up to 1 ppm, you'll want an iron-specific filter for concentrations above that threshold.
